Latest Patents
Ghenya Krochik holds a patent for an "Internet of Things (IoT) mediation and adaptation secure application gateway." This invention involves a method, a non-transitory computer readable medium, and a primary server designed for transferring data over a communication network from an IoT device. The method includes receiving a data packet from the IoT device on an application running on a primary server. The data packet features a stateless autoconfiguration IPv6 address, which is configured at least partially based on a device identifier assigned to the IoT device. The process modifies the stateless autoconfiguration IPv6 address associated with the IoT device identifier to generate a global IP address with the application running on the primary server. Finally, the data packet with the global IP address is sent from the primary server to one or more secondary servers over the communication network. Ghenya has 1 patent to his name.
